How much do records associate jobs pay per hour?

As of Jun 14, 2026, the average hourly pay for records associate in Virginia is $20.08,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$17.16 and $20.96 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Records Associate,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Records Associate, you need strong organizational skills, attention to detail, and a high school diploma or equivalent, with some positions preferring coursework in information management. Familiarity with electronic records management systems (ERMS), databases, and office software like Microsoft Office is typically required. Strong communication, discretion, and the ability to prioritize tasks make someone stand out in this role. These skills ensure accurate record-keeping, data security, and efficient retrieval, which are critical for regulatory compliance and smooth business operations.

What are some common challenges faced by Records Associates, and how can they be managed effectively?

Records Associates often face challenges such as managing large volumes of documents, ensuring accurate data entry, and maintaining compliance with retention policies. To manage these effectively, it's important to develop strong organizational skills, stay up-to-date on relevant regulations, and utilize document management systems proficiently. Collaborating closely with other departments and regularly reviewing processes can also help streamline workflows and reduce errors.

The main difference between a Records Associate and a Data Entry Clerk lies in their scope of responsibilities. Records Associates typically handle more complex record management tasks, ensuring data accuracy and compliance, often within specialized industries like healthcare or legal sectors. Data Entry Clerks primarily focus on inputting data quickly and accurately into systems, often performing repetitive tasks. Both roles require strong attention to detail and computer skills, but Records Associates usually require a broader understanding of recordkeeping procedures.

What does a records associate do?

A records associate is responsible for organizing, maintaining, and retrieving company or organization records, often using database management systems. They ensure data accuracy, compliance with privacy policies, and may handle document scanning, filing, and data entry tasks. Strong attention to detail and familiarity with record-keeping software are important for this role.

What are Records Associates?

Records Associates are professionals responsible for managing, organizing, and maintaining company records and documents. They ensure that information is accurately filed, accessible, and complies with legal and regulatory requirements. Their duties often include data entry, filing, retrieving documents, and assisting with records retention and destruction processes. Records Associates play a key role in supporting business operations by safeguarding important information and ensuring efficient document management.
